4 # Make command line options:
5 #       -DNO_CLEANDIR run ${MAKE} clean, instead of ${MAKE} cleandir
6 #       -DNO_CLEAN do not clean at all
7 #       -DNO_SHARE do not go into share subdir
8 #       -DKERNFAST define NO_KERNEL{CONFIG,CLEAN,DEPEND,OBJ}
9 #       -DNO_KERNELCONFIG do not run config in ${MAKE} buildkernel
10 #       -DNO_KERNELCLEAN do not run ${MAKE} clean in ${MAKE} buildkernel
11 #       -DNO_KERNELDEPEND do not run ${MAKE} depend in ${MAKE} buildkernel
12 #       -DNO_KERNELOBJ do not run ${MAKE} obj in ${MAKE} buildkernel
13 #       -DNO_PORTSUPDATE do not update ports in ${MAKE} update
14 #       -DNO_DOCUPDATE do not update doc in ${MAKE} update
15 #       -DNO_WWWUPDATE do not update www in ${MAKE} update
16 #       -DNO_CTF do not run the DTrace CTF conversion tools on built objects
17 #       LOCAL_DIRS="list of dirs" to add additional dirs to the SUBDIR list
18 #       LOCAL_LIB_DIRS="list of dirs" to add additional dirs to libraries target
19 #       LOCAL_MTREE="list of mtree files" to process to allow local directories
20 #           to be created before files are installed
21 #       LOCAL_TOOL_DIRS="list of dirs" to add additional dirs to the build-tools
22 #           list
23 #       TARGET="machine" to crossbuild world for a different machine type
24 #       TARGET_ARCH= may be required when a TARGET supports multiple endians
25 #       BUILDENV_SHELL= shell to launch for the buildenv target (def:/bin/sh)
26
27 #
28 # The intended user-driven targets are:
29 # buildworld  - rebuild *everything*, including glue to help do upgrades
30 # installworld- install everything built by "buildworld"
31 # doxygen     - build API documentation of the kernel
32 # update      - convenient way to update your source tree (eg: cvsup/cvs)
33 #
34 # Standard targets (not defined here) are documented in the makefiles in
35 # /usr/share/mk.  These include:
36 #               obj depend all install clean cleandepend cleanobj

53 # We must do share/info early so that installation of info `dir'
54 # entries works correctly.  Do it first since it is less likely to
55 # grow dependencies on include and lib than vice versa.
56 #
57 # We must do lib/ and libexec/ before bin/, because if installworld
58 # installs a new /bin/sh, the 'make' command will *immediately*
59 # use that new version.  And the new (dynamically-linked) /bin/sh
60 # will expect to find appropriate libraries in /lib and /libexec.

198 #
199 # Building a world goes through the following stages
200 #
201 # 1. legacy stage [BMAKE]
202 #       This stage is responsible for creating compatibility
203 #       shims that are needed by the bootstrap-tools,
204 #       build-tools and cross-tools stages.
205 # 1. bootstrap-tools stage [BMAKE]
206 #       This stage is responsible for creating programs that
207 #       are needed for backward compatibility reasons. They
208 #       are not built as cross-tools.
209 # 2. build-tools stage [TMAKE]
210 #       This stage is responsible for creating the object
211 #       tree and building any tools that are needed during
212 #       the build process.
213 # 3. cross-tools stage [XMAKE]
214 #       This stage is responsible for creating any tools that
215 #       are needed for cross-builds. A cross-compiler is one
216 #       of them.
217 # 4. world stage [WMAKE]
218 #       This stage actually builds the world.
219 # 5. install stage (optional) [IMAKE]
220 #       This stage installs a previously built world.
221 #
